The census is the mainstay for American Genealogy. It puts each family in a location every ten years, from 1790-1950. Location by county and state is important as it leads the researcher to other records. The county is the basic record holding unit for land and tax records, wills, and probate records, court records, plus others. All these records may provide clues to further your research. | The census is the mainstay for American Genealogy. It puts each family in a location every ten years, from 1790-1950.
